Eddie and the Cruisers (1983): This mid 1980's film told the story of a 1960's musical gang who winds up celebrated in the wake of playing gigs all through New Jersey. After this band, apropos named Eddie and the Cruisers, makes a collection that is everything Eddie trusted it would be, the collection is dismissed by the leader of the record organization. Crushed, Eddie drives his vehicle off a scaffold and Eddie, just as his reject collection, vanishes. After twenty years, a TV maker chooses to do a narrative on Eddie and the Cruisers and reconnects with a significant number of the band mates, every one of whom have proceeded onward. It is during this time a more seasoned looking Eddie reemerges, in this manner setting up the spin-off: Eddie and the Cruisers II: Eddie Lives.

Not exclusively did this motion picture address the disappointment and penances of the music business, yet it likewise set an obscure band up for life: John Cafferty and the Beaver Brown Band. Playing out the soundtrack to the first and the continuation, John Cafferty and the Beaver Brown band discharged the signature tune of the motion picture, "On the Dark Side;" it was a hit single can even now be heard on present-day radio stations.

This is Spinal Tap (1984): A Rob Reiner coordinated mockumentary, This is Spinal Tap includes a substantial metal musical gang and its wild conduct. A film that makes jokes about the music business,


certain scenes outraged a few performers, at any rate at first, hitting fairly up close and personal. Be that as it may, when individuals acknowledged they shouldn't pay attention to themselves in this way, the aim of the motion picture - to be mocking and ridicule self importance - was made progressively selfevident.

Huge numbers of the scenes were extemporized and promotion libbed, leaving the result interesting to numerous watchers. This is Spinal Tap was recorded as 64 on Bravo's 100 Funniest Movies and moved to 29 on AFI's 100 Years...100 Laughs. It was additionally immediately made into a clique exemplary and considered, in 2002, as socially noteworthy by the Library of Congress. From here, it was picked for conservation in the National Film Registry.

That Thing You Do (1996): Any movie that is composed by, coordinated by, and stars Tom Hanks must be great: this film was only that. Occurring in the 1960's, this film highlights Hanks as an administrator of the Wonders, a one-hit wonder with Beatles-like suggestions. As the Wonders climb their approach to distinction, jumping on the radio and inevitably increasing a record contract and visiting broadly, the establishments inside the band start to unwind. The band before long pursues.

Comprised of an elite player cast, including Tom Everett Scott, Steve Zahn, Liv Tyler, Charlize Theron, Rita Wilson, and Giovanni Ribisi, That Thing You Do likewise includes top pick music with a soundtrack that incorporates music by Rick Elias, Scott Rogness, and Howard Shore. The motion picture's most paramount tune, "That Thing you Do," reflected fiction when it turned into a hit and helped dispatch the profession of Fountains of Wayne.

Practically Famous (2000): Written and coordinated by Cameron Crowe, Almost Famous was only that practically well known - when it went to its not as much as square rave execution in the cinematic world. Basically, be that as it may, it got high approval including four Academy Award designations. Eminent film pundit Roger Ebert considered it the "best motion picture of the year."

Following the voyage of William Miller, Almost Famous tells the story of a youngster trapped in a hurricane of franticness, energy, and desire when he visits with a musical gang. A semi-autographical story, this motion picture depends on Crowe's understanding as a youthful author visiting with Led Zeppelin.

Musically, Almost Famous won the Grammy for Best Compilation Soundtrack Album for a Motion Picture, Television or Other Visual Media. The film highlighted tunes from Elton John, Simon and Garfunkel, Thunderclap Newman, Peter Frampton, and Nancy Wilson.


Dreamgirls (2006): Released broadly on Christmas Day 2006, Dreamgirls turned into a hit, winning three Golden Globes and two Oscars. Adjusted from the 1981 Broadway melodic, Dreamgirls is set in the 1960's and 1970's; it pursues the vocations of The Dreamettes, a Detroit bunch with a solid likeness to The Supremes. Dreamgirls brings us into the universe of R&B and the Motown development that changed our country.

Dreamgirls might be best recognized as propelling the movie vocation of Jennifer Hudson, a previous American Idol challenger.
